Lyon by Washburn Stratocaster

My first electric guitar package was Lyon by Washburn.  After a long battle of searching online and
reading reviews about guitar and which music store to buy, I have decided to
just go to the nearest music store in Southampton to look, try and then
hopefully buy an electric guitar.

I tried a couple of shops which were adjacent to each other,
tried to look at the guitars and was a bit shy to try one.  Because of my tight budget plus being the new
kid in town, I was really shy to test their guitar.  But then, I conquered my shyness and tried a
couple, and finally decided to buy this Lyon electric guitar by Washburn,
colour black bundled with gig bag, 10-watt Stagg practise amp, strap, 3
plectrums and 3-meter lead.

The guitar is superb, double humbucker bridge pickup, and
two single coil’s, 5-way toggle switch, 1 volume knob and 1 tone knob.  The action was fairly decent, but the sound
or tone quality was rather brilliant.
The store was clever coz I didn’t realize I was using a high-end
amplifier, which is not the one included with the bundle, not the 10-watt Stagg
practise amp.

After buying the guitar, I went home and hooked up
everything and tried using the practise amp, the sound was rubbish especially
using the built-in overdrive although, on clean tone, using the neck pickup, it
is performing well.  The one good thing
about this practise amp is the MP3 input as well as the headset output where it’s
easy and convenient to jam in my room.
